﻿brainpy.synouts.COBA
====================

.. currentmodule:: brainpy.synouts

.. autoclass:: COBA

   
   .. automethod:: __init__

   
   .. rubric:: Methods

   .. autosummary::
   
      ~COBA.__init__
      ~COBA.add_aft_update
      ~COBA.add_bef_update
      ~COBA.add_inp_fun
      ~COBA.clear_input
      ~COBA.clone
      ~COBA.cpu
      ~COBA.cuda
      ~COBA.desc
      ~COBA.filter
      ~COBA.get_aft_update
      ~COBA.get_bef_update
      ~COBA.get_delay_data
      ~COBA.get_delay_var
      ~COBA.get_inp_fun
      ~COBA.get_local_delay
      ~COBA.has_aft_update
      ~COBA.has_bef_update
      ~COBA.jit_step_run
      ~COBA.load_state
      ~COBA.load_state_dict
      ~COBA.nodes
      ~COBA.register_delay
      ~COBA.register_implicit_nodes
      ~COBA.register_implicit_vars
      ~COBA.register_local_delay
      ~COBA.register_master
      ~COBA.reset
      ~COBA.reset_local_delays
      ~COBA.reset_state
      ~COBA.save_state
      ~COBA.setattr
      ~COBA.state_dict
      ~COBA.step_run
      ~COBA.sum_current_inputs
      ~COBA.sum_delta_inputs
      ~COBA.sum_inputs
      ~COBA.to
      ~COBA.tpu
      ~COBA.tracing_variable
      ~COBA.train_vars
      ~COBA.tree_flatten
      ~COBA.tree_unflatten
      ~COBA.unique_name
      ~COBA.update
      ~COBA.update_local_delays
      ~COBA.vars
   
   

   
   
   .. rubric:: Attributes

   .. autosummary::
   
      ~COBA.after_updates
      ~COBA.before_updates
      ~COBA.cur_inputs
      ~COBA.current_inputs
      ~COBA.delta_inputs
      ~COBA.implicit_nodes
      ~COBA.implicit_vars
      ~COBA.isregistered
      ~COBA.mode
      ~COBA.name
      ~COBA.non_hashable_params
      ~COBA.supported_modes
      ~COBA.master
   
   